About 1 Park View
1 Park View is a semi-detached house in Beech Hill, Reading, Reading (RG7 2BA). It has a recorded floor area of 109 m² (around 1173 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(July 2018) shows an E (score 51),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. Earlier certificates rated it D (January 2017); the latest reading is one band lower. Between certificates, wall efficiency dropped from Good to Poor and window ef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 82), a 3-band jump. Main heating runs on oil.
At 109 m² it's 16.6% larger than the typical home in the postcode (94 m² median across 6 EPCs). On energy efficiency it sits in the bottom 10% of properties in this postcode — significant headroom for improvement. One historical planning record sits against the property in 2024.

1 Park View has no Land Registry sales on file,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ands since registration began.
£501,000
Modelled from EPC, postcode comparables.
No sales recorded with HM Land Registry
That can mean the property has never traded since the registry began publishing in 1995, was a new build that hasn't been registered yet, or is held in the same hands long-term.
